Skywalking 9如何与大数据平台结合?
在当今大数据时代,企业对业务监控和性能优化的需求日益增长。作为一款强大的APM(Application Performance Management)工具,Skywalking 9凭借其高性能、可扩展性和易用性,成为了许多企业的首选。那么,Skywalking 9如何与大数据平台结合,实现业务监控和性能优化的双重目标呢?本文将为您详细解析。
一、Skywalking 9简介
Skywalking 9是一款开源的APM工具,它可以帮助企业实时监控和优化业务性能。Skywalking 9具有以下特点:
- 高性能:采用轻量级架构,对系统性能影响极小。
- 可扩展性:支持分布式部署,可满足大规模业务需求。
- 易用性:提供丰富的可视化图表和报告,便于用户快速上手。
- 多语言支持:支持Java、C#、PHP等多种编程语言。
二、大数据平台简介
大数据平台是指用于处理和分析海量数据的平台。随着企业业务的快速发展,大数据平台在业务监控和性能优化中扮演着越来越重要的角色。常见的大数据平台有Hadoop、Spark、Flink等。
三、Skywalking 9与大数据平台结合的优势
- 数据整合:Skywalking 9可以将业务监控数据、系统性能数据等整合到大数据平台,实现统一管理和分析。
- 实时监控:通过大数据平台,可以实时监控业务性能,及时发现并解决问题。
- 数据可视化:利用大数据平台丰富的可视化工具,可以直观地展示业务性能、系统资源等数据。
- 数据挖掘:通过对大数据平台中数据的挖掘和分析,可以为企业提供有价值的信息,助力业务优化。
四、Skywalking 9与大数据平台结合的实现方式
- 数据采集:Skywalking 9通过Agent技术,将业务监控数据、系统性能数据等采集到本地存储。
- 数据传输:将采集到的数据通过Skywalking 9的Data Collector模块,传输到大数据平台。
- 数据存储:大数据平台将接收到的数据存储到相应的数据存储系统中,如HDFS、MySQL等。
- 数据处理与分析:利用大数据平台的技术,对存储的数据进行实时监控、分析、挖掘等操作。
五、案例分析
某电商企业采用Skywalking 9与Hadoop平台结合,实现了以下效果:
- 实时监控:通过Skywalking 9,企业可以实时监控业务性能,及时发现并解决系统瓶颈。
- 性能优化:通过对Hadoop平台中数据的分析,企业发现部分业务存在性能瓶颈,并针对性地进行了优化。
- 成本降低:通过优化业务性能,企业降低了服务器资源消耗,降低了运维成本。
六、总结
Skywalking 9与大数据平台的结合,为企业提供了强大的业务监控和性能优化能力。通过本文的介绍,相信您已经对Skywalking 9与大数据平台结合的实现方式有了清晰的认识。在实际应用中,企业可以根据自身需求,选择合适的技术方案,实现业务监控和性能优化的双重目标。
猜你喜欢:微服务监控